Fruit juices are acidic in nature as their are some organic acid present in it . For example : orange and lemons contains citric acid , tartric acid in tamarind and unripe grapes and oxalic acid in tomatoes . it is not harmful to eat or drink substances containing naturally occuring acids in them .
